A West Virginia Turkey Hunt This week Cameron shares the story and audio of his hunt in West Virginia from the spring 2020 turkey season. This is a very exciting hunt with lots of gobbling from a few toms surrounded by a big flock of very vocal hens. The audio of this hunt is really good, and it is interesting as well because for some strange reason, Cameron left his recorder and microphone behind with his turkey vest while he made a move on the toms. So, we get to hear his calling and the toms gobbling from a distance. It is as if we were in the woods with Cameron letting him move ahead to low crawl on the turkeys. There is a great story to go along with this hunt as Cameron shares what happened after the shot. Listen in to this hunt and enjoy!
